close Warning: Can't synchronize with repository "(default)" (The repository directory has changed, you should resynchronize the repository with: trac-admin $ENV repository resync '(default)'). Look in the Trac log for more information.

Changeset 1450


Ignore:
Timestamp:
2015-06-12T10:57:51-07:00 (9 years ago)
Author:
Marek Rychlik
Message:

* empty log message *

File:
1 edited

Legend:

Unmodified
Added
Removed
  • branches/f4grobner/5am-tests.lisp

    r1449 r1450  
    325325    (is (every #'poly-equal-no-sugar-p (colon-ideal ring-and-order I J) I-colon-J))))
    326326
     327(test poly-lcm
     328  "Polynomial LCM"
     329  (let* (($poly_grobner_algorithm :buchberger)
     330         (I (cdr (string->poly "[x^2*y,x*y^2]" '(x y))))
     331         (J (cdr (string->poly "[x,y]" '(x y))))
     332         (ring *ring-of-integers*)
     333         (order #'lex>)
     334         (ring-and-order (make-ring-and-order :ring ring :order order))
     335         (I-colon-J (cdr (string->poly "[x*y]" '(x y)))))
     336    (is (every #'poly-equal-no-sugar-p (colon-ideal ring-and-order I J) I-colon-J))))
     337
    327338
    328339(run! 'ngrobner-suite)
Note: See TracChangeset for help on using the changeset viewer.